Sometimes we want to spend less time labouring over our faces and more time out enjoying life. And that’s why we turn to beauty life hacks. Or should I say beauty hacks are a trophy for lazy beauties? Here I have compiled the top 20 beauty hacks, read on to know it:

(1) FULLER LIPS WITH ESSENTIAL OIL

Use a small drop of peppermint essential oil on your fingertip and apply it to your lips. Let your lips absorb the oil for 2-3 minutes before applying a lip gloss to plump your lips.

(2) APPLY MASCARA USING BUSINESS CARD

When applying mascara, hold a business card behind your lashes and apply it in a back and forth motion starting at the roots. You can really put it on this way, coating every lash fast.



(3) LONGER LASHES WITH POWDER

Dust some translucent powder on your lashes between coats. This will make your lashes look much fuller.

(4) WHITE NAIL POLISH AS BASE COAT

Use a coat of white nail polish instead of a base coat. This will make your nail colour stand out more. It will still protect your nails from becoming stained by coloured polishes.

(5) FOUNDATION FIX WITH TURMERIC

If you accidentally purchase a foundation that’s too dark, adding a bit of moisturizer to your mix can help lighten it or turmeric powder to darken the foundation.

(6) CURL LASHES USE HAIR DRYER

Use your hairdryer to slightly heat your eyelash curler. Let it cool a bit, then use as you normally would. The heat will set the curl so it lasts longer.

(7) LIP BALM AS BROW GEL

Use a small amount of lip balm on your eyebrows and then brush them with a spooly to set them in place.

(8) MATTE NAIL COLOR WITH CORN STARCH

Love the look of matte nails? Make your own matte nail polish by mixing any loose powder eyeshadow or corn starch in with a clear polish, then painting the mixture on your nails.



(9) FILL EYEBROW WITH MASCARA

If you have perfectly shaped eyebrows then use brown or black mascara to lightly fill in your brows. Using a q-tip, clean up all the smudges and mistakes.

(10) NATURAL LIP & CHEEK STAIN


Use a fresh beet as the perfect lip and cheek stain. Run a slice of freshly cut beet on the lips or cheek or dab coconut oil on a cotton swab then run the beet on the swab before applying.

(11) EYELINER AS GEL LINER

Simply place the tip of the eyeliner pencil over a flame for one second. Wait about 15 seconds for it to cool down, and apply. This will make eyeliner easier to apply because it makes it softer.

(12) MATTE LIQUID LIPSTICK WITH OIL

Matte texture tends to dry out the lips, so if you have chapped lips then moisturize your lips by using a small amount of argan, coconut or sweet almond oil on your lips, thus, preparing the lips to keep matte lipstick fresh.

(13) STICKY BOBBY PINS

Bobby pins slipping and sliding all over the place? Place them on a paper towel and give them a quick spritz of hairspray to make them sticky. These “sticky pins” will stay in your hair much better.

(14) CAMOUFLAGE GREY HAIR


If you want to camouflage some strands of grey hair on the go, then use mascara if you have dark hair. For blondes or redheads try dusting your roots with bronzing powder.

(15) ICE CUBE AS MAKEUP PRIMER


Prime Skin before patting on foundation, run an ice cube over your face (wrapped in a paper towel) , focusing on areas with enlarged pores. The cold water will cause pores to reduce in size and minimize their appearance under makeup for a flawless smooth look and make your makeup last long.

One of the best ways to protect your hair during the winter is to maintain the health of the skin from which it grows - the scalp!

“During the winter months, the best way to treat common winter scalp problems such as drying, flaking, or itching, is to do a deep cleansing for the scalp. Most of the time, we tend to pay attention to the hair, but focusing on the scalp is a must,” says celebrity hairstylist Nelson Vercher.

“The best way to do this is to use a pre-cleansing oil treatment on scalp, before you shampoo and condition. I also advise to shampoo more often in the winter time, because you get much more build up on the scalp during winter.”

“My holy trinity combo is Rene Furterer Complexe 5 ($49, dermstore.com), raw cold pressed coconut oil and tea tree oil. Alternate between the three of these and follow with a very moisturizing shampoo and conditioner. Your scalp will be healthy, which really helps the hair grow strong from inside out.”

Before washing, Emmy Award winning Andre Walker -Oprah Winfrey’s former hairstylist of over 30 years and co-founder of Andre

Walker Hair- advises to “brush or massage your scalp before cleansing to stimulate blood circulation to promote a healthy scalp and to remove any flaking from dryness.”

“This also helps to bring natural oils to the surface which are great for your hair, but also help to seal in your scalp’s natural moisture. At this stage, you should use a natural oil like Mongongo to massage into your scalp. Mongongo is one of the few oils that have healing and moisturizing properties.”

“Shampoo with a mild paraben and sulfate free moisturizing shampoo to keep your scalp clean. Using my Ultimate

Moisture Shampoo ($10, target.com) not only cleanses but it's also very gentle and helps your scalp to maintain moisture without any harsh ingredients to dry your scalp. Increasing your water intake is also important. This helps to hydrate your entire body as well as you scalp. You can't drink too much water,” says Walker.
